16863864 has 32 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 44640720. Its totient is φ = 5290496.
The previous prime is 16863863. The next prime is 16863901. The reversal of 16863864 is 46836861.
It is a happy number.
It is a nude number because it is divisible by every one of its digits.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(16863863)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 20259 + ... + 21074.
Almost surely, 216863864 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
16863864 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(27776856).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
16863864 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
16863864 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 41359 (or 41355 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its digits is 165888, while the sum is 42.
The square root of 16863864 is about 4106.5635268433. The cubic root of 16863864 is about 256.4399579795.
The spelling of 16863864 in words is "sixteen million, eight hundred sixty-three thousand, eight hundred sixty-four".
